Abstract

Advances in digital infrastructure and increased accessibility to a broader swath of society has promoted open innovation on digital platforms at the largest scale in our history. While the increased participation of society in helping to solve a broad range of problems is something to be celebrated, we should also recognize that this scaling-up has introduced several challenges that require us as a discipline to revisit how we envision the orchestration of open innovation. These challenges pertain to the social mechanisms that are traditionally leveraged to orchestrate open innovation and inherent human biases that can be counterproductive to bringing problems and ideal solutions together. In this research, we advance a theoretical framework that gives primacy to the role of algorithms in orchestrating open innovation on digital platforms at large scale. Owing to their superiority in processing vast amounts of data and recognizing patterns at large scale, we see algorithms as playing an important complementary role alongside human participants in the open innovation process. We conclude by outlining an initial research agenda.
